To mitigate these risks, assisted housing facilities incorporate hob shut off mechanisms into their kitchen appliances. These mechanisms are designed to automatically shut off the hob after a certain period of time or if it detects that the hob has been left unattended. This feature not only prevents accidents but also promotes energy efficiency by reducing the consumption of electricity or gas.
The hob shut off mechanism is typically integrated into the control panel of the appliance. When activated, the hob will automatically turn off after a set amount of time, usually between 15 to 60 minutes. This ensures that even if a resident forgets to turn off the hob after cooking, the shut off mechanism will kick in and prevent any potential accidents.
Furthermore, some hob shut off mechanisms are equipped with sensors that can detect abnormal temperature increases or fluctuations. If the sensor detects a sudden increase in temperature, it will automatically shut off the hob to prevent any fire hazards. This advanced feature adds an extra layer of safety and protection for residents, giving them peace of mind while using the kitchen appliances.
